### Runbook: Report export timezone mismatches (Glimmerfield)

If a customer reports that exported totals differ from the dashboard, check whether their report schedule predates the March cutover — older schedules still render in server-local time rather than the account timezone. Re-saving the schedule fixes it. Before escalating, confirm the export worker is running with the expected timezone settings shown below.

config for kadup-kajog:
[raldor]
host = raldor.tolvaqworks.internal
user = raldor_svc
database = raldor_prod

Subject: Quindell launch — plan locked

All: Quindell ships 14 weeks out. Marketing assets final by end of month. Pricing approved at tier-two positioning. Channel briefings for the Northvale and Carrow regions start next week; Priya owns scheduling. Manufacturing confirms 20k units at launch, 8k monthly after. No press activity before embargo lift. Department heads: confirm resourcing by Friday, escalate gaps to me directly. One open item remains on bundling with the Sarrow accessory line. Final sequencing follows the plan set out below.

management briefing: The renewal with Zoraelax Group closes at $10 million a year, 15 percent below the last contract. Project Ralael slips by six weeks because of the audit delay.

TURN-208: Gatevale turnstile counters at the Merrow Field pilot double-count when a rotation reverses mid-cycle. Attendance totals drift roughly 2% high per event. The debounce window fix is implemented, reviewed by Ilsa, and soak-tested across two simulated match days without drift. Ready for your cut; the candidate build is identified below.

trace token, tagag-tafog: htk6_5ed18c